Bose 102

Installation Speakers
From LSI January 1986
Unobtrusiveness is not a quality that normally distinguishes a PA speaker, but the new 102 range from Bose performs "with both accuracy and power" contained within a near-invisible enclosure, say the company. It is not a traditional ceiling speaker, but a carefully optimised 200-cubic inch flush-mounting acoustic enclosure specifically designed for unob- trusive installation or retrofitting. Compact, flexible, and easy to install it is able to offer a full bandwidth response at high sound pressure levels, with wide dispersion and high reliability. The system is designed for shops, hotels and any background applications, but it is also capable of handling a full-blown disco. The dual-port reflex design gives the best possible bass end. It includes a pre-wired 5-position level switch and factory-installed multi-tap transformer. Front and rear wiring access plates are provided and the whole unit requires only 3% in wall or ceiling depth. The Bose 102 (which comes in flush-mounting or surface mounting configurations) is available in a number of variants for 70 or 100 volt line operation at 8 or 25 watts, or 8 ohm, 25 watt, giving up to 101dBA SPL at 10 ft at 1 kHz. The frequency response is an impressive 80 H2-18 - / - 3dB. With identical performance specifications, the sound contractor can choose any combination of surface and flush mount Bose 102 enclosures, The third element in the 102 system is the System Controller, a unique unit offering two channels of music equalisation, allowing stereo or two-zone mono operation. The channels feature balanced differential inputs with sensitivity switches that can be set up for 100mv or 1 volt. The exclusive Optivoice circuitry in the System Controller automatically reduces the music level for voice overs, and then gradually restores it after the end of the message. Band-limiting equalisation and compression maximises voice-channel in- telligibility, giving a smooth and easily understood announcement quality. Overall, the Bose 102 is a commercial sound system that combines all the traditional Bose qualities of ruggedness, reliability, sound and power, with cost-effectiveness and ease of in- stallation, adding up to a system that is unique in the marketplace, say the manufacturers.
